Under Geely, Lotus could add crossovers to lineup

Lotus Cars' new Chinese owner reckons that Porsche's successful expansion into crossovers could be a template for the struggling U.K. sports car maker, a senior executive said.

Zhejiang Geely Holding Group signed a deal in June to buy a majority stake in Lotus from its Malaysian owner, DRB-Hicom, securing the future of the company. Now Geely is making plans to turn Lotus into a money maker.

"It has a brand image that hasn't faded," said Carl-Peter Forster, a Geely board member and chairman of Geely-owned London taxi maker LEVC. "It's small volume, but we all believe there is more opportunity than the 1,500 to 2,000 vehicles that are currently sold."

Forster, a former CEO of General Motors Europe, cited Porsche's rapid growth after launching the Cayenne crossover in 2002.

Lotus could easily expand to produce "any size of car and any number of cars" without straying from its brand focus on agile, lightweight cars, Forster said on the sidelines of the Frankfurt auto show. "If you look at a pretty famous southern German sports car manufacturer, they were able to expand the brand without diluting it.”

Lotus CEO Jean-Marc Gales has talked about producing an SUV in the past, but the project seems to have stalled in recent months.

LEVC's new plug-in hybrid London taxi uses a lightweight aluminum platform constructed in much the same way Lotus builds its sports cars. Forster said there would be cost synergies between the companies.

"The team will be happy to provide support if Lotus requires support," Forster said.
